# 1. Developement environment preparing

   1. install `"Arduino Software IDE"` for your preferred operating system  
`https://www.arduino.cc -> Software->Downloads`  
it is strongly recommended to use older version `"1.6.8"`, by which we can assure correct compilation results  
_note: in versions `1.7.x` and `1.8.x` there are known some C/C++ compilator disasters, which disallow correct source code compilation (you can obtain `"... internal compiler error: in extract_insn, at ..."` error message, for example); we are not able to affect this situation afraid_  
_note: name collision for `"LiquidCrystal"` library known from previous versions is now obsolete (so there is no need to delete or rename original file/-s)_

   2. add (`UltiMachine`) `RAMBo` board into the list of Arduino target boards  
`File->Preferences->Settings`  
into text field `"Additional Boards Manager URLs"`  
type location  
`"https://raw.githubusercontent.com/ultimachine/ArduinoAddons/master/package_ultimachine_index.json"`  
or you can 'manually' modify the item  
`"boardsmanager.additional.urls=....."`  
at the file `"preferences.txt"` (this parameter allows you to write a comma-separated list of addresses)  
_note: you can find location of this file on your disk by following way:  
`File->Preferences->Settings`  (`"More preferences can be edited in file ..."`)_  
than do it  
`Tools->Board->BoardsManager`  
from viewed list select an item `"RAMBo"` (will probably be labeled as `"RepRap Arduino-compatible Mother Board (RAMBo) by UltiMachine"`  
_note: select this item for any variant of board used in printers `'Prusa i3 MKx'`, that is for `RAMBo-mini x.y` and `EINSy x.y` to_  
'clicking' the item will display the installation button; select choice `"1.0.1"` from the list(last known version as of the date of issue of this document)  
_(after installation, the item is labeled as `"INSTALLED"` and can then be used for target board selection)_  


# 2. Source code compilation

place the source codes corresponding to your printer model obtained from the repository into the selected directory on your disk  
`https://github.com/prusa3d/Prusa-Firmware/`  
in the subdirectory `"Firmware/variants/"` select the configuration file (`.h`) corresponding to your printer model, make copy named `"Configuration_prusa.h"` (or make simple renaming) and copy them into `"Firmware/"` directory  

run `"Arduino IDE"`; select the file `"Firmware.ino"` from the subdirectory `"Firmware/"` at the location, where you placed the source codes  
`File->Open`  
make the desired code customizations; **all changes are on your own risk!**  

select the target board `"RAMBo"`  
`Tools->Board->RAMBo`  
_note: it is not possible to use any of the variants `"Arduino Mega …"`, even though it is the same MCU_  

run the compilation  
`Sketch->Verify/Compile`  

upload the result code into the connected printer  
`Sketch->Upload`  

or you can also save the output code to the file (in so called `HEX`-format) `"Firmware.ino.rambo.hex"`:  
`Sketch->ExportCompiledBinary`  
and then upload it to the printer using the program `"FirmwareUpdater"`  
_note: this file is created in the directory `"Firmware/"`_
